I have an untyped DataSet object and a typed DataSet class, by design the
structures match, I want to cast!!! my untyped DataSet object into with my
typed
DataSet class. Can I do this, whitout having to manually copy the data
between the untyped to the typed ?

Miha Markic said:
Hi,

No, since typed dataset is derived from untyped.
